The project

Biochem Nightshift is a horror puzzle game developed by students at Futuregames, inspired by the universe of H.P. Lovecraft. Players assume the role of Fredrik, a newly hired process operator navigating the eerie corridors of Ulrichs Medizin Wissenschaft. Renck Productions contributed to the project by providing the voice for the character Bertha Schneider, enhancing the game’s immersive atmosphere.

About FutureGames

Futuregames is a leading Swedish game development and tech school with campuses in Stockholm, Malmö, Karlstad, Skellefteå, and Boden. Established nearly 20 years ago, it offers Higher Vocational Education (YH) programs focused on hands-on learning and close collaboration with industry partners. Programs include Game Design, Game Programming, Game Art, and more, with many taught in English to attract an international student body.

Futuregames has been recognized among the top game development schools globally, with alumni making up over 14% of the Swedish games industry. The school emphasizes real-world experience through project-based learning and internships, helping students transition directly into careers at studios like Ubisoft, Avalanche Studios, and EA DICE.
